Georgians for the Arts is looking for fourteen strong, exceptional, and dedicated arts advocates possessing the top-notch leadership skills to help make a difference.

District Captain respon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• to serve on the Georgians for the Arts Federal Advisory Council and to assist with the advancement and development of the mission,
  • to serve as the Georgian for the Arts’ designated representative and primary contact for the Congressional District,
  • to help Georgians for the Arts to keep Georgia’s Congressional District Representative updated with arts and culture news and activities,
  • to assist Georgians for the Arts with monitoring and responding to legislative actions within the U.S. House of Representatives,
  • to assist Georgians for the Arts with recruiting and supporting State Senatorial District Captains within the Congressional District.

Advocacy training will be provided, and the fourteen Congressional District Captains will be part of an exclusive network to support Georgians for the Arts, its members, and arts advocates throughout Georgia.

Time commitments depend mainly on the level of activity within Congress, the frequency needed to meet as an Advisory Council, and the need to fulfill the responsibilities.

About Georgians for the Arts

Georgians for the Arts, a 501(c)4, is the state’s leading arts and culture advocacy organization with a mission to provide vision, leadership, and resources that ensure the growth, prosperity, and sustainability of arts and culture in Georgia; and Georgia’s representative to Americans for the Arts’ State Arts Advocacy Network.

Georgians for the Arts advances its mission through year-round arts and culture advocacy activities, year-round programs for artists, and the networking of artists, arts educators, local arts organizations, and business leaders all working towards a better Georgia.
